Вопрос

Я пытаюсь включить изображение в электронное письмо, которое отправляется с помощью mailto:URL-адрес в приложении для iPhone.Изображение отображается в почтовом приложении отправителя, но после отправки тег, похоже, полностью удален.Вот фрагмент, экранированный вручную:

[mailUrl appendString:@"&body=%3Cimg%20src%3D%22http%3A//stackoverflow.com/content/img/stackoverflow-logo.png%22%20/%3E"];

Если не использовать собственный SMTP-сервер или отправлять их в виде вложений, есть ли способ встроить изображения в электронное письмо на iPhone?

Это было полезно?

Решение

Нет, сделать это с помощью iPhone SDK до версии 2.2.1 невозможно.

Есть способ сделать это с помощью SDK 3.0, но он находится под соглашением о неразглашении, поэтому я не могу обсуждать его здесь :(

Другие советы

http://webbuilders.wordpress.com/2009/11/16/url-must-be-url-encoded-inside-a-nsstring-in-objective-c/

Эта новая учетная запись не позволит мне опубликовать свой ответ.Я включаю сюда информацию

Люк, возможно, тебе это больше не пригодится, но, исследуя эту тему, кто-то упомянул, что перенос изображения с помощью <b></b> запрещает почтовому приложению iPhone удалять тег img.Я попробовал это, и это работает для меня.

Лицензировано под: CC-BY-SA с атрибуция
Не связан с StackOverflow
scroll top